You can apply for or cancel an extension to opening hours online (by logging in with eHerkenning).
The local authority will process your application within 4 weeks.
The costs for this licence are as follows:
- €233.60 (one-off payment) for Sunday to Thursday nights up to 04.00
- €175.21, payable once for the night from Friday to Saturday and from Saturday to Sunday.
- €175.21, payable once for a one-off extension.
The municipality of Apeldoorn generally observes the following opening hours:
- Sunday to Thursday from 6.00 am to 1.00 am
- Fridays and Saturdays from 6.00 am to 2.00 am
If you have a licence to remain open until 4.00 am, you must have a doorman on Friday and Saturday nights. This also applies to eating establishments that serve alcoholic drinks after standard closing time. Without a doorman, you will not be granted a licence to stay open later.
For catering establishments, such as a shawarma shop, the rules are as follows:
- If you have a licence to stay open until 4.00 am, you are still permitted to admit visitors after 3.00 am
- On Fridays and Saturdays, after 2.00 am, you may only serve non-alcoholic drinks
- If you do wish to continue serving alcoholic drinks, you must not admit any more visitors to your premises from 03.00 onwards.
As a general rule, we do not grant licences to hospitality businesses located outside Apeldoorn’s nightlife and CCTV coverage areas.
